#21370f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#21370f is composed of 12.9% red, 21.6%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.7% yellow and 78.4% black. It has a hue angle of 93 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 13.7%. #21370f color hex could be obtained by blending #426e1e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#21370f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050902 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#21370f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232422 is the less saturated color, while #204402 is the most saturated one.
